Ditty Dots: I wanted it to be more than a music class 💕
🧡 I had my first child during the height of the pandemic & we were pretty much in lockdown for the best part of the first year... No baby classes, no new mum friends, minimal socializing (2m apart and just one walk a day else might end up in prison - seems crazy now!)
👯 Of course, all the pandemic babies missed out on things but I think the mums did too a little bit. I know how valuable support is during those early times; I was so incredibly lucky to have my husband and my Mum but some people didn't have that.
🎵 When setting up Ditty Dots, as important as the content of the classes, was the priority of choosing the right venues. I wanted venues that allowed people to socialize before/ after class. I wanted to provide opportunity for friendships and support networks to gradually and naturally build.
⚡ The vibe in class is really relaxed, welcoming, friendly, non-judgemental, but to now see parents and children who didn't know each other before, playing together - well, it might have brought a tear to my eye 🤣 (I was setting up the room, looked out the window, saw this, grabbed my camera and ran!)
The venue in Towcester is on market square - surrounded by great brunch and coffee spots ( , , ). We also have a private garden for use in the warmer months.
The venue in town is on a BIG playing field with a great playground and facilities. There's also a few pubs nearby 🙌
I wanted Ditty Dots to be more than a music class, and this beautiful moment earlier shows that it is becoming that 🧡
